    Yes, you can directly appear for LPUNEST Phase 2 without taking Phase 1. There is no mandatory link between the phases, and students can register for any phase based on their convenience.

    Each LPUNEST phase serves as a separate opportunity for admission and scholarships at Lovely Professional University (LPU). However, since scholarships are awarded on a first-come, first-served basis, students appearing in earlier phases often have a better chance of securing higher scholarship amounts.

    Lovely Professional University (LPU) conducts its National Entrance and Scholarship Test (LPUNEST) in multiple phases throughout the academic year. Each phase operates independently, allowing candidates the flexibility to apply for any phase without the necessity of participating in a previous one. Therefore, you can directly register for LPUNEST 2020 Phase 2 without having attempted Phase 1. Dear, Yes, if you miss the first phase of LPU NEST, you can still apply for the next phase. Lovely Professional University conducts LPU NEST in multiple phases each year to give students several chances to appear for the exam and qualify for admission or scholarships. You simply need to check the updated schedule on the official LPU website and complete the registration process for the upcoming phase. However, applying in the earlier phases is recommended, as it often provides better chances for higher scholarships and early admission to preferred programs.

Dear, Yes, you can appear for the  LPU NEST exam again.

Lovely Professional University allows candidates to appear in multiple phases of LPU NEST to improve their scores. To take the exam in a subsequent phase, the candidates must submit the application form again on the official website.

Each phase of the  LPU NEST is treated separately, and the candidates will receive a new score and rank based on their performance in that phase of the exam.
